Yoshi reported the total area of the five great lakes on the chart above.

To the nearest thousand, which is the best estimate of the difference between the total area of the great lakes beginning with a consonant and the total area of great lakes beginning with a vowel?

Answer:

60000 square miles

Explanation:

Step 1: Great lakes beginning with consonant: Huron, Michigan, Superior

Great lakes beginning with vowel: Ontario, Erie

Step 2: Estimate the areas to nearest thousand.

Estimation of area of Huron = 23000 square miles

Estimation of area of Michigan = 22000 square miles

Estimation of area of Superior = 32000 square miles

Total area of Great lakes beginning with a consonant = 23000 + 22000 + 32000 = 77000 square miles

Estimation of area of Ontario = 7000 square miles

Estimation of area of Erie = 10000 square miles

Total area of Great lakes beginning with a vowel = 7000 + 10000 = 17000 square miles

Step 3: Difference between the total area of Great lakes beginning with a consonant and the vowel

77000 – 17000 = 60000 square miles
